Amazon Echo Hub Gets a Fresh New Look and Enhanced Smart Home Features

Amazon is rolling out a free software update for its Echo Hub devices, focusing on a much-needed redesign of the home screen interface. This update aims to provide users with a cleaner, more intuitive, and fully customizable layout that can display more smart home information and controls than its predecessor.

Integration with Ring’s AI Features

One of the most notable aspects of this update is the integration of Ring’s AI-powered features. Specifically, the Echo Hub will now have access to Ring’s Video Search feature, which allows users to search through their smart home camera footage using natural language. This feature significantly simplifies the process of finding specific moments or events captured by the cameras, making it more efficient for users to review and manage their camera footage.

Additionally, the Echo Hub will provide Alexa Plus summaries of detected camera events. This means that users will receive concise updates on any notable events captured by their smart home cameras, such as motion detection or other alerts, directly through their Echo Hub. This integration enhances the smart home security aspect of the Echo Hub, offering users a more comprehensive view of their home’s security status.
